Mobile Certification Lab Conformance Test Engineer – 704778
Description
Job Description: This position is for the Intel Mobile Certification Lab Conformance Engineer as part of the Standards & Advanced Technology Division within Intel’s Mobile and Communications Group. The successful candidate will be responsible for official GCF/PTCRB conformance testing of Intel’s GSM/UMTS/HSPA+/LTE wireless modules and devices. Responsibilities include certification issue debugging and analysis of RF and Protocol Stack, alignment with product R&D business groups, planning and execution of day to day lab operations, continuous improvement of lab processes to minimize test times, establish test methodologies and processes, which includes maintaining test lab documentation such as test lab descriptions, diagrams, guidelines, procedures, and inventory control system; implementing processes to document precise workflow guidelines; installing, configuring, and operating conformance test equipment and test management systems; managing hardware and software configurations and updates; and preparing and delivering conformance certification test reports.

Business Group
Employees in the Intel Architecture Group (IAG) deliver innovative platforms across computing and communication segments including data centers, mobile and desktop personal computers, handhelds, embedded devices and consumer electronics. Intel’s industry leading technology is used to create integrated hardware and software solutions such as processors, chipsets, communication radios, graphics processors, motherboards, and networking components that deliver capabilities from security and manageability to computing performance and energy efficiency. IAG employees are at the forefront of enabling a new era of computing that is more integrated into all aspects of our daily lives.
